![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() | Re: BMW 1-Series Coupe Official Press Release Prices (German market - incl 19% VAT): 120d: €28,750 ....... (eg. 120d 3dr: €26,800; 320d coupe: €35,600; 320d sedan: €32,000) 123d: €32,500 ........ (eg. 325d coupe (197PS): €38,100; 325d sedan (197PS): €35,250) 135i : €38,950 ........ (eg. 130i 3dr: €35,300 - incl M-package; 335i coupe: €44,650; 335i sedan: €40,800) Exterior Colors: Black Crimson Red (from 12/07) Alpine White (from 12/07) Sedona Red (New! 1er coupe exclusive) Sapphire Black metallic Titanium Silver metallic Montego Blue metallic Sparkling Graphite metallic Tahiti Green metallic (New! from 12/07) Crystal Blue metallic (New! from 12/07) Monaco Blue metallic (from 12/07) Kashmir Silver metallic (New! 1er coupe exclusive from 12/07) Le Mans Blue metallic (only available with 337 M-Sport package) Interior trims: Light Titanium (Standard 120d, 123d) Brushed Aluminium (Standard 135i) Black Gloss Kashmir Silver Nut Wood Light Poplar Wood Gray Upholstery: Cloth ‚Elektra’; Anthracite (Standard 120d) - not avail. with Sports seats Cloth ‚Network’ ; Anthracite or Monaco Blue (Standard 123d, 135i) Cloth + Leather ‚Pearlpoint’ ; Anthracite + Orange or Beige - only available with Sports seats Leather ‚Boston’ ; Black or Alaska Grey or Beige or Terra or Lemon or Coral Red Wheels: 7J x 16 Double-Spoke Style 222; 205/55 R16 (Standard 120d) 7J x 17 V-Spoke Style 141; 205/50 R17 (Standard 123d) 7J x 17 Star-Spoke Style 256; 205/50 R17 7/7,5 J x 17 Star-Spoke Style 142; 205/50 R17 front, 225/45 R17 rear 7/7,5 J x 17 Star_Spoke Style 262; 205/50 R17 front, 225/45 R17 rear 7,5/8,5 J x 18 W-Spoke Style 263: 215/40 R18 front, 245/35 R18 rear 7,5/8,5 J x 18 Star-Spoke Style 264; 215/40 R18 front, 245/35 R18 rear (Standard 135i) M-Sport package Wheels: Double-Spoke Style 207 M; 205/50 R17 front, 225/45 R17 rear Double-Spoke Style 261 M (2MR); 215/40 R18 front, 245/35 R18 rear Interesting features: M-sport package comes without fog lights! 123d & 135i include Electronic Differential Lock function in DSC-off mode only 120d & 123d (not 135i) come with Automatic Start&Stop function (only avail with manual gearbox) all three models come with 6-speed manual gearbox standard & Braking Energy Regeneraton & Active Aerodynamics & Optimal Gear Display & Servotronic steering 6-speed automatic available from 03/08 Last edited by Harry Plopper; 06-30-2007 at 08:28 PM.. |

![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() | Re: BMW 1-Series Coupe Official Press Release Quote:
Press pics & videos show 135i in Sedona Red color. Standard 135i features kind a special yet standard Performance package including: M-sport chassis with special setting, ultra-performance brakes, ultra-performance throttle setting, DSC+ functions, EDL, M-Sport aerodynamic body kit, chromed exterior trim, chromed kidney grill bars, sports seats, sports steering wheel. While the ordering guide says regular M-Sport package is optional & analog to hatch M-Sport package (incl. M-Sport chassis settings, M-sport aerodynamic body kit, M-sport sport steering wheel, M-sport stick, sports seats & all the regular M-Sport interior & exterior trims eg. Shadow Line, Anthracite, M-logos, etc) . Regarding foglights: standard 135i comes without them. They are even not mentioned as an option. While eg. hatch specific M-Sport package includes fog lights ... so if it is really analog ... ![]() So - I guess - if you order M-Sport package with 135i you only get interior & exterior M Sport trim + M Rims extra on standard 135i package. ![]() I also guess "no-fog-lights" feature is 135i specific due a need for a larger air intake (for engine & brakes cooling). ![]() | Re: BMW 1-Series Coupe Official Press Release I'm confused. The UK press release gave me the feeling that the 135i come standard w/ the M-sport pkg. See copy and paste below. The BMW 120d Coupé will be available in ES, SE and M Sport guises, while the 123d Coupé will be offered in SE and M Sport and the 135i Coupé just as an M Sport. M Sport raises the specification bar by including 17-inch light alloy wheels on the 120d and 123d Coupé but unique 18-inch light alloy wheels on the 135i Coupé, M Aerodynamic package, M Sports suspension, Sports seats, High-gloss Shadowline exterior trim, M leather steering wheel, M designation door sills and Anthracite headlining. The 135i I see in the photos have the chrome exterior trim and and the interior pics don't have M anything.
